Abstract:
The aim of this contribution is to derive a complete deterministic description of the Ultra-WideBand (UWB) wireless channel where major antennas effects, i.e. polarization, frequency dependence and directivity, are taken into account. Our analysis relies on a ray tracing UWB channel model since this reflects the dependence on the Angle of Arrival (AoA) and Angle of Departure (AoD) of any multipath. A mathematical framework for the whole chain of the UWB system is given. Simulation results show the dependance of the performance, e.g. on rotating the transmitting and receiving antennas, of an Impulse Radio (IR) based UWB communication system.
